About AI Engineering Services Limited

AIESL is a leading engineering services provider in the Indian aviation sector, established to support maintenance, repair, and overhaul (MRO) activities. Selected candidates will be posted in New Delhi, working on critical aircraft maintenance projects. This recruitment specifically targets the Trainee Aircraft Maintenance Engineer post, offering a stable career path within the civil aviation infrastructure.

Eligibility Criteria

Educational Qualification

Candidates must have passed all B1 or B2 Modules of DGCA or hold a B1/B2 DGCA License within AIESL capability (RT License preferred). In addition to academic qualifications, practical experience is crucial. Applicants must have a minimum of 05 years of aviation experience, with at least 2 years of service specifically in AIESL.

Age Limit

The maximum age limit for applicants is 52 years. Candidates should verify their exact age as of the cutoff date specified in the official notification.

Nationality

The applicant must be an Indian citizen.

Selection Process

The selection process for this recruitment is based on a merit assessment. Candidates found suitable by a committee constituted for the assessment of eligibility criteria shall be considered for the post. While there is no written exam mentioned, the committee will rigorously evaluate your DGCA license status, years of experience, and specific tenure at AIESL. Ensure all your documentation is precise and verifiable.
